#1c9d0c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1c9d0c is composed of 11% red, 61.6% green and 4.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 92.4% yellow and 38.4% black. It has a hue angle of 113.4 degrees, a saturation of 85.8% and a lightness of 33.1%. #1c9d0c color hex could be obtained by blending #38ff18 with #003b00.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

Shades and Tints of #1c9d0c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020b01 is the darkest color, while #f9fef8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1c9d0c
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#545654 is the less saturated color, while #17a406 is the most saturated one.
